Eggplant Parmesan Italian Casserole

Featured in: Comfort Plates

This Italian-inspired dish layers tender slices of breaded eggplant with marinara sauce, creamy ricotta, and shredded mozzarella cheese. The casserole is baked to perfection with a golden Parmesan crust, creating a rich, comforting meal. Ideal for family dinners or gatherings, it combines savory herbs and cheeses for a classic taste. Alternative preparations like grilling eggplant offer lighter versions, while gluten-free substitutions keep it accessible. Paired with fresh basil garnish and a glass of Chianti, it’s a hearty vegetarian main perfect for cozy occasions.

Updated on Thu, 13 Nov 2025 11:52:00 GMT
Golden-brown Eggplant Parmesan Lasagna, layered with hearty sauce and bubbly mozzarella. Save
Golden-brown Eggplant Parmesan Lasagna, layered with hearty sauce and bubbly mozzarella. | tastychuck.com

A comforting, Italian-inspired casserole layering tender eggplant, rich tomato sauce, creamy ricotta, and gooey mozzarella, finished with a golden Parmesan crust. Perfect for family dinners or gatherings.

I first made this Eggplant Parmesan Lasagna for my family on a chilly Sunday evening, and it immediately became one of our favorite comfort meals. The combination of gooey mozzarella and golden Parmesan topping always has everyone scraping their plates clean.

Ingredients

  • Eggplants: 2 large, sliced lengthwise into 1/2-inch thick slices
  • Salt: 1 tablespoon, for sweating eggplant
  • All-purpose flour: 1 cup
  • Eggs: 2 large, beaten
  • Italian-style breadcrumbs: 1 1/2 cups
  • Ricotta cheese: 2 cups
  • Mozzarella cheese: 2 cups shredded
  • Parmesan cheese: 3/4 cup grated
  • Pecorino Romano cheese (optional): 1/2 cup grated
  • Marinara sauce: 4 cups (homemade or store-bought)
  • Olive oil: 2 tablespoons
  • Garlic: 3 cloves, minced
  • Onion: 1 small, finely chopped
  • Dried oregano: 1/2 teaspoon
  • Dried basil: 1/2 teaspoon
  • Salt and pepper: to taste
  • Lasagna noodles: 9 no-boil noodles (or regular, pre-cooked)
  • Fresh basil leaves: 1/4 cup, chopped (for garnish)

Instructions

Prep and Sweat Eggplant:
Preheat the oven to 400°F (200°C). Lay eggplant slices on a baking sheet and sprinkle both sides with salt. Let sit for 30 minutes to draw out moisture, then pat dry with paper towels.
Bread the Eggplant:
Dredge each slice in flour, dip in beaten eggs, then coat in breadcrumbs.
Bake Eggplant Slices:
Arrange breaded eggplant on a parchment-lined baking sheet. Drizzle with olive oil and bake for 20 minutes, flipping halfway, until golden and tender.
Make Tomato Sauce:
Heat 2 tablespoons olive oil in a saucepan over medium heat. Sauté onion until soft, about 5 minutes. Add garlic and cook 1 minute more. Stir in marinara sauce, oregano, basil, salt, and pepper. Simmer for 10 minutes.
Prepare Ricotta Mixture:
Mix ricotta cheese with half of the Parmesan and all of the Pecorino Romano (if using). Season with salt and pepper.
Reduce Oven and Assemble Lasagna:
Reduce oven to 375°F (190°C). Spread a thin layer of sauce on bottom of a 9x13-inch baking dish. Place 3 lasagna noodles over sauce. Layer half the baked eggplant slices over noodles. Spread half of the ricotta mixture, then sprinkle with 1/3 of the mozzarella. Add another layer of sauce. Repeat with remaining noodles, eggplant, ricotta, and mozzarella. Top with final noodles, remaining sauce, and remaining mozzarella and Parmesan.
Bake:
Cover dish with foil and bake for 30 minutes. Uncover and bake 15 minutes more, until top is bubbly and golden.
Cool and Serve:
Let rest 10–15 minutes before slicing. Garnish with fresh basil.
A steaming dish of Eggplant Parmesan Lasagna, showing off the perfectly melted mozzarella. Save
A steaming dish of Eggplant Parmesan Lasagna, showing off the perfectly melted mozzarella. | tastychuck.com

Gathering around the table to dig into this bubbling eggplant lasagna always brings my family together for cozy conversation and second helpings. Everyone from kids to grandparents looks forward to the cheesy middle and crispy topping.

Required Tools

Baking sheet, parchment paper, 9x13-inch baking dish, saucepan, mixing bowls, whisk, knife, and cutting board

Allergen Information

Contains wheat (flour, breadcrumbs, lasagna noodles), eggs, and milk (ricotta, mozzarella, Parmesan, Pecorino Romano). Double-check ingredient labels if using packaged products.

Nutritional Information

Per serving: 510 calories, 23 g total fat, 48 g carbohydrates, 26 g protein

Fresh basil garnishes this delicious Eggplant Parmesan Lasagna, baked to golden perfection. Save
Fresh basil garnishes this delicious Eggplant Parmesan Lasagna, baked to golden perfection. | tastychuck.com

Let the lasagna rest before slicing for perfect layers. Garnish with fresh basil to add color and bright flavor.

Recipe Guide

How should eggplant be prepared before baking?

Slice the eggplant and salt both sides to draw out moisture. After 30 minutes, pat dry to reduce bitterness and improve texture before breading and baking.

Can the eggplant be grilled instead of baked?

Yes, grilling the eggplant slices is a lighter alternative that adds a smoky flavor while maintaining tenderness before layering.

What cheeses are used in this dish?

Ricotta, shredded mozzarella, grated Parmesan, and optionally Pecorino Romano are combined for a creamy and flavorful cheese blend.

How is the sauce prepared?

A marinara sauce is sautéed with garlic, onion, oregano, basil, and olive oil, then simmered to develop rich Italian flavors.

Are there gluten-free options for this dish?

Substituting gluten-free breadcrumbs and noodles allows for a gluten-free version without compromising taste.

What are suitable serving suggestions?

This hearty casserole pairs well with a light red wine such as Chianti and can be garnished with fresh chopped basil for added aroma.

Eggplant Parmesan Italian Casserole

Italian-style layered casserole with eggplant, tomato sauce, ricotta, mozzarella, and Parmesan cheese baked golden.

Prep duration
30 min
Heat time
60 min
Full duration
90 min
Created by Chuck Harrison


Skill level Medium

Heritage Italian-American

Output 6 Portions

Nutrition Labels Meat-free

What you'll need

Vegetables

01 2 large eggplants, sliced lengthwise into 1/2-inch thick slices
02 1 tablespoon salt (for sweating eggplant)

Breading

01 1 cup all-purpose flour
02 2 large eggs, beaten
03 1 1/2 cups Italian-style breadcrumbs

Cheeses

01 2 cups ricotta cheese
02 2 cups shredded mozzarella cheese
03 3/4 cup grated Parmesan cheese
04 1/2 cup grated Pecorino Romano cheese (optional)

Sauce

01 4 cups marinara sauce (homemade or store-bought)
02 2 tablespoons olive oil
03 3 cloves garlic, minced
04 1 small onion, finely chopped
05 1/2 teaspoon dried oregano
06 1/2 teaspoon dried basil
07 Salt and pepper, to taste

Assembly

01 9 no-boil lasagna noodles (or regular, pre-cooked)
02 1/4 cup fresh basil leaves, chopped (for garnish)

Method

Phase 01

Preheat oven: Preheat the oven to 400°F (200°C).

Phase 02

Prepare eggplant: Lay eggplant slices on a baking sheet and sprinkle both sides with salt. Let sit for 30 minutes to draw out moisture, then pat dry with paper towels.

Phase 03

Bread eggplant: Dredge each eggplant slice in flour, dip in beaten eggs, then coat evenly with breadcrumbs.

Phase 04

Bake eggplant: Arrange breaded slices on a parchment-lined baking sheet, drizzle with olive oil, and bake for 20 minutes, flipping halfway, until golden and tender.

Phase 05

Prepare sauce: Heat 2 tablespoons olive oil in a saucepan over medium heat. Sauté onion until translucent, about 5 minutes. Add garlic and cook 1 minute more. Stir in marinara sauce, oregano, basil, salt, and pepper, then simmer for 10 minutes.

Phase 06

Mix cheeses: In a bowl, combine ricotta with half the Parmesan and all Pecorino Romano if using. Season with salt and pepper.

Phase 07

Reduce oven temperature: Reduce oven temperature to 375°F (190°C).

Phase 08

Assemble layers: In a 9x13-inch baking dish, spread a thin layer of sauce. Place 3 lasagna noodles over sauce, layer half the baked eggplant, spread half the ricotta mixture, and sprinkle with one-third of the mozzarella. Add another sauce layer, then repeat with remaining noodles, eggplant, ricotta, and mozzarella. Top with final noodles, remaining sauce, mozzarella, and Parmesan.

Phase 09

Bake assembled dish: Cover with foil and bake for 30 minutes. Uncover and bake 15 minutes more until bubbly and golden on top.

Phase 10

Rest and garnish: Let rest for 10 to 15 minutes before slicing. Garnish with chopped fresh basil.

Kitchen tools

  • Baking sheet
  • Parchment paper
  • 9x13-inch baking dish
  • Saucepan
  • Mixing bowls
  • Whisk
  • Knife and cutting board

Allergy alerts

Always review ingredients for potential allergens and seek professional medical guidance if unsure
  • Contains wheat (flour, breadcrumbs, noodles), eggs, and milk (ricotta, mozzarella, Parmesan, Pecorino Romano).

Nutrition breakdown (per portion)

Values shown are estimates only - consult healthcare providers for specific advice
  • Energy: 510
  • Fats: 23 g
  • Carbohydrates: 48 g
  • Proteins: 26 g